+// Copyright 2009 The Go Authors. All rights reserved.
+// Use of this source code is governed by a BSD-style
+// license that can be found in the LICENSE file.
+
+// NOTE: If you change this file you must run "./mkbuiltin"
+// to update builtin.c.boot. This is not done automatically
+// to avoid depending on having a working compiler binary.
+
+package PACKAGE
+
+// emitted by compiler, not referred to by go programs
+
+func new(int32) *any
+func panicindex()
+func panicslice()
+func throwreturn()
+func throwinit()
+func panicwrap(string, string, string)
+
+func panic(interface{})
+func recover(*int32) interface{}
+
+func printbool(bool)
+func printfloat(float64)
+func printint(int64)
+func printuint(uint64)
+func printcomplex(complex128)
+func printstring(string)
+func printpointer(any)
+func printiface(any)
+func printeface(any)
+func printslice(any)
+func printnl()
+func printsp()
+func goprintf()
+
+// filled in by compiler: int n, string, string, ...
+func concatstring()
+
+// filled in by compiler: Type*, int n, Slice, ...
+func append()
+func appendslice(typ *byte, x any, y []any) any
+
+func cmpstring(string, string) int
+func slicestring(string, int, int) string
+func slicestring1(string, int) string
+func intstring(int64) string
+func slicebytetostring([]byte) string
+func sliceinttostring([]int) string
+func stringtoslicebyte(string) []byte
+func stringtosliceint(string) []int
+func stringiter(string, int) int
+func stringiter2(string, int) (retk int, retv int)
+func slicecopy(to any, fr any, wid uint32) int
+func slicestringcopy(to any, fr any) int
+
+// interface conversions
+func convI2E(elem any) (ret any)
+func convI2I(typ *byte, elem any) (ret any)
+func convT2E(typ *byte, elem any) (ret any)
+func convT2I(typ *byte, typ2 *byte, elem any) (ret any)
+
+// interface type assertions x.(T)
+func assertE2E(typ *byte, iface any) (ret any)
+func assertE2E2(typ *byte, iface any) (ret any, ok bool)
+func assertE2I(typ *byte, iface any) (ret any)
+func assertE2I2(typ *byte, iface any) (ret any, ok bool)
+func assertE2T(typ *byte, iface any) (ret any)
+func assertE2T2(typ *byte, iface any) (ret any, ok bool)
+func assertI2E(typ *byte, iface any) (ret any)
+func assertI2E2(typ *byte, iface any) (ret any, ok bool)
+func assertI2I(typ *byte, iface any) (ret any)
+func assertI2I2(typ *byte, iface any) (ret any, ok bool)
+func assertI2T(typ *byte, iface any) (ret any)
+func assertI2T2(typ *byte, iface any) (ret any, ok bool)
+
+func ifaceeq(i1 any, i2 any) (ret bool)
+func efaceeq(i1 any, i2 any) (ret bool)
+func ifacethash(i1 any) (ret uint32)
+func efacethash(i1 any) (ret uint32)
+
+// *byte is really *runtime.Type
+func makemap(mapType *byte, hint int64) (hmap map[any]any)
+func mapaccess1(mapType *byte, hmap map[any]any, key any) (val any)
+func mapaccess2(mapType *byte, hmap map[any]any, key any) (val any, pres bool)
+func mapassign1(mapType *byte, hmap map[any]any, key any, val any)
+func mapassign2(mapType *byte, hmap map[any]any, key any, val any, pres bool)
+func mapiterinit(mapType *byte, hmap map[any]any, hiter *any)
+func mapiternext(hiter *any)
+func mapiter1(hiter *any) (key any)
+func mapiter2(hiter *any) (key any, val any)
+
+// *byte is really *runtime.Type
+func makechan(chanType *byte, hint int64) (hchan chan any)
+func chanrecv1(chanType *byte, hchan <-chan any) (elem any)
+func chanrecv2(chanType *byte, hchan <-chan any) (elem any, received bool)
+func chansend1(chanType *byte, hchan chan<- any, elem any)
+func closechan(hchan any)
+
+func selectnbsend(chanType *byte, hchan chan<- any, elem any) bool
+func selectnbrecv(chanType *byte, elem *any, hchan <-chan any) bool
+func selectnbrecv2(chanType *byte, elem *any, received *bool, hchan <-chan any) bool
+
+func newselect(size int) (sel *byte)
+func selectsend(sel *byte, hchan chan<- any, elem *any) (selected bool)
+func selectrecv(sel *byte, hchan <-chan any, elem *any) (selected bool)
+func selectrecv2(sel *byte, hchan <-chan any, elem *any, received *bool) (selected bool)
+func selectdefault(sel *byte) (selected bool)
+func selectgo(sel *byte)
+func block()
+
+func makeslice(typ *byte, nel int64, cap int64) (ary []any)
+func growslice(typ *byte, old []any, n int64) (ary []any)
+func sliceslice1(old []any, lb uint64, width uint64) (ary []any)
+func sliceslice(old []any, lb uint64, hb uint64, width uint64) (ary []any)
+func slicearray(old *any, nel uint64, lb uint64, hb uint64, width uint64) (ary []any)
+
+func closure() // has args, but compiler fills in
+
+// only used on 32-bit
+func int64div(int64, int64) int64
+func uint64div(uint64, uint64) uint64
+func int64mod(int64, int64) int64
+func uint64mod(uint64, uint64) uint64
+func float64toint64(float64) int64
+func float64touint64(float64) uint64
+func int64tofloat64(int64) float64
+func uint64tofloat64(uint64) float64
+
+func complex128div(num complex128, den complex128) (quo complex128)
